For the first game of the day, I already have Kane Williamson, Craig Williams and David Wiese in my fantasy side. I just have to bring in another bowling option - Trent Boult, whose left-arm angle and ability to pick up wickets with both the new ball and in the death overs hold him in good stead.

Mitchell Santner, who I picked ahead of Ish Sodhi in the previous New Zealand game, is also someone I will keep tabs on.

As for the second game of the day, I already have two Indian bowlers in Jasprit Bumrah and Mohammed Shami to take care of my bowling needs. Bringing in one or two Indian batters would be a good ploy.

KL Rahul is my first choice for the same, although Virat Kohli and Rohit Sharma are also decent options to consider ahead of Friday's second game.

Who else but Kane Williamson? Although the Kiwi captain has been in decent touch over the past year or so, he hasn't scored many runs lately. Given that this is a must-win game for New Zealand, I expect Williamson to come up with a good performance against a potent Namibian bowling attack.

With conditions helping swing bowling, Trent Boult is another obvious pick, but I will also be considering David Wiese at the time of the toss.

KL Rahul is my preference for one differential pick for the second game of the day. Rahul looked in good touch against Afghanistan and if he is to continue his rich vein of form, another big day beckons in the fantasy league.

As for the second differential selection, Jasprit Bumrah is the preferred choice with the express pacer due for a couple of wickets in the T20 World Cup 2021.
